Jolene blazer
Jolene is a semi-fitted, fully lined blazer with a defined waist. The front and back feature side panels. The fitted silhouette is achieved through princess seams in the front and both princess seams and a center seam in the back. The blazer has faced front pockets set into the seams. The long, set-in, two-piece sleeves have vents with sewn-on buttons in the elbow seam. The blazer has a classic notched collar and a single-breasted button closure. Jolene is below-hip length.

Approximate sewing time – 2 days (16 hours).
To sew this blazer, choose medium-weight, soft, non-stretch or low-stretch, opaque suiting fabrics made of natural fibers, artificial fibers, blends, or synthetics.
Recommended fabrics: corduroy, denim, jacquard, suiting.
Attention! We do not recommend stretchy knit fabrics and lightweight sheer fabrics (chiffon, organza, stretch lace).
The blazer in the photos is made of jacquard. The fabric is medium weight, soft, and low-stretch. The fiber content is 8% silk + 44% polyamide + 48% polyester. The fabric weight is 178 g/m2.
The fiber content of the lining is 100% viscose. The lining fabric weight is 100 g/m2.
